如何在电脑中轻松启动MySQL数据库:详细步骤指南

资源类型:00-7.net 2025-07-09 02:38

电脑中启动mysql数据库简介:



高效启动MySQL数据库:从安装到优化全面指南 在当今信息化社会,数据库作为数据存储和管理的核心组件,其重要性不言而喻

    MySQL,作为开源数据库管理系统中的佼佼者,凭借其高性能、可靠性和易用性,在众多应用场景中占据了主导地位

    无论是开发小型Web应用,还是构建大型企业级系统,MySQL都是不可或缺的一部分

    本文将详细介绍如何在电脑中高效启动MySQL数据库,涵盖安装、配置、启动、管理以及性能优化等关键环节,确保您能够迅速上手并充分利用MySQL的强大功能

     一、安装MySQL:奠定坚实基础 1. 选择合适的MySQL版本 在正式安装之前,首先需要根据你的操作系统(如Windows、macOS、Linux)以及具体需求选择合适的MySQL版本

    对于大多数用户而言,社区版(Community Edition)已经足够强大且免费

    访问MySQL官方网站下载页面,选择对应操作系统的安装包

     2. 安装步骤 -Windows系统:下载.MSI安装包后,双击运行,按照向导提示完成安装

    过程中可以选择默认配置或自定义安装路径、端口号等

     -macOS系统:通过Homebrew安装最为便捷

    打开终端,输入`brew install mysql`即可

     -Linux系统:对于Ubuntu/Debian系,使用`sudo apt-get install mysql-server`;对于RedHat/CentOS系,使用`sudo yum install mysql-server`

    安装完成后,根据系统提示完成初始化配置

     3. 验证安装 安装完成后,通过命令行检查MySQL服务状态

    在Windows上,可以在“服务”管理器中查找MySQL服务;在macOS和Linux上,可以分别使用`brew services list`或`systemctl status mysqld`命令

     二、配置MySQL:定制化设置以满足需求 1. 配置文件编辑 MySQL的主要配置文件是`my.cnf`(Linux/macOS)或`my.ini`(Windows),通常位于MySQL安装目录下或`/etc/mysql/`路径中

    通过编辑此文件,可以调整缓冲池大小、日志文件路径、连接数限制等关键参数

     -缓冲池大小:对于InnoDB存储引擎,`innodb_buffer_pool_size`应设置为物理内存的70%-80%,以优化读写性能

     -日志文件:合理设置log_bin(二进制日志)、`slow_query_log`(慢查询日志)等,有助于故障恢复和性能调优

     2. 用户与权限管理 使用`mysql -u root -p`命令登录MySQL后,可以通过`CREATE USER`、`GRANT`等SQL语句创建新用户并分配权限

    注意,出于安全考虑,应为每个用户分配最小必要权限

     3. 字符集与排序规则 确保数据库使用UTF-8或UTF-8MB4字符集,以避免字符编码问题

    在配置文件中设置`character-set-server`和`collation-server`,或在创建数据库时指定字符集和排序规则

     三、启动MySQL:轻松上手 1. 服务启动 -Windows:在服务管理器中启动MySQL服务,或通过命令提示符执行`net start mysql`

     -macOS/Linux:使用`brew services start mysql`(macOS)或`systemctl start mysqld`(Linux)命令启动服务

     2. 命令行连接 安装并启动MySQL服务后,通过命令行工具连接到MySQL数据库

    使用`mysql -u用户名 -p`命令,输入密码后即可进入MySQL命令行界面

     3. 图形化管理工具 为了提高管理效率,可以考虑使用MySQL Workbench、phpMyAdmin等图形化管理工具

    这些工具提供了直观的用户界面,便于执行SQL查询、管理数据库对象、监控服务器状态等

     四、管理MySQL:日常运维与优化 1. 备份与恢复 定期备份数据库是保障数据安全的基本措施

    MySQL支持多种备份方式,如物理备份(使用Percona XtraBackup等工具)、逻辑备份(使用`mysqldump`命令)

    备份完成后,应定期进行恢复测试,确保备份的有效性

     2. 性能监控 利用MySQL自带的性能模式(Performance Schema)或第三方监控工具(如Prometheus、Grafana结合mysqld_exporter)持续监控数据库性能指标,如查询响应时间、连接数、锁等待时间等

    一旦发现异常,及时采取措施进行优化

     3. 查询优化 针对慢查询,首先使用`EXPLAIN`语句分析查询执行计划,识别瓶颈所在

    然后,通过添加合适的索引、优化SQL语句、调整表结构等方式提升查询效率

    此外,定期分析和优化表(使用`ANALYZE TABLE`和`OPTIMIZE TABLE`命令)也是必要的维护步骤

     4. 日志管理 定期清理旧的日志文件,避免占用过多磁盘空间

    同时,定期检查错误日志和慢查询日志,及时发现并解决潜在问题

     五、结语:持续学习与探索 MySQL作为一个功能强大的数据库管理系统,其深度和广度远不止于此

    从基础安装到高级优化,每一步都蕴含着丰富的知识和技巧

    随着技术的不断进步,MySQL也在不断演进,引入新功能,提升性能

    因此,作为数据库管理员或开发者,保持持续学习的态度至关重要

    无论是通过阅读官方文档、参与社区讨论,还是实践中的不断摸索,都能帮助我们更好地掌握MySQL,为项目提供坚实的数据支持

     总之,高效启动MySQL数据库不仅是对技术细节的精准把握,更是对数据库管理理念的深刻理解和实践

    通过上述步骤,相信您已经掌握了如何在电脑中顺利启动并有效管理MySQL数据库的方法

    未来,无论是面对复杂的业务场景,还是追求极致的性能表现,MySQL都将成为您值得信赖的伙伴

    

阅读全文
上一篇:CentOS上安装MySQL客户端指南

最新收录:

  • 控制台操作:如何关闭MySQL服务器
  • Python实战:如何将CSV数据高效写入MySQL数据库
  • MySQL技巧:如何更新一列值为另一列的值
  • MySQL如何创建Data目录指南
  • MySQL数据库CPU占用高,如何优化?
  • MySQL教程:如何修改数据字段的长度限制
  • 如何将MySQL数据库内容修改为空
  • MySQL教程:如何查看某表的所有属性字段
  • MySQL如何存储数组?数据库存储技巧揭秘
  • 如何快速安装py-mysql库
  • 如何将MySQL数据库打包并通过邮件发送
  • MySQL数据合计技巧撰写指南
  • 首页 | 电脑中启动mysql数据库:如何在电脑中轻松启动MySQL数据库:详细步骤指南